Stockholes Turbary occupies a flat, reclaimed expanse of the Humberhead Levels where the horizon stretches wide and indifferent under a heavy, grey sky. It lies 2.4 miles north-north-west of Epworth (from Epworth: bearing 335°T, OS grid SE 765 072), and is situated west-north-west of Belton village. Low-lying fields define the character of Stockholes Turbary, where the earth retains the damp memory of ancient, drained peat bogs. A short distance to the south-south-west, the Hatfield Chase Ditches SSSI serves as a reminder of the complex hydraulic engineering required to tame this stubborn, sodden landscape.
